Minimogue VA for those of you who can use Vsti's. This thing is pretty cool for a freebie... It's a monosynth, like the original. I have the commercial Arturia Minimoog emulation, and yet I like the Minimogue almost as much. It even has a simulation for Oscillator drift, which helps give it a more authentic sound.

I sometimes load up two instances of it in XLutop chainer for a fatter sound, and sometimes add a sprinkling of add on effecst. It's easy on the Cpu vs the commercial Arturia version.

Check out the Arp 2600 emulation on the same page. It is pretty nice for a freebie too. Thanks much to Glen Stegner for these.
